Will Poulter (We are the millers, The bear, Death of a unicorn) made its debut in MCU in Guardians of the Galaxy Vol. 3in which he played the character Adam Warlock, a sovereign created by his mother Ayesha as a living weapon designed to kill the guardians of the galaxy.

He was prematurely awakened by a high evolutionary, who commissioned him to capture Rocket, only that Adam’s efforts were contrasted by the Guardians. His arch of the story continued and, despite his programming, he approached and became a good boy, taking sides with his guardians and saving the life of Star-Lord.

But the road to give life to the character was disconnected for Poulter and explained some accident that took place during the shooting. The actor explained in an interview on The Jonathan Ross Show:

“We are doing this combat sequence and I grew up looking at Dave [Bautista]as a wrestler and then as an actor. I’m a little nervous. I didn’t do a lot of combat choreography. However, we are doing this combat scene and I accidentally gave a handful to Dave in the face. “

Poulter, who was painted by gold for the role, continued to tell seeing Bautista who was supposed to be invented because he had a golden punch imprinted by the eyes. “You realize when you do movies, you’re much better by delivering acrobatic people,” added Poulter.
